Konami Secure Dragon Booster News

Konami announce agreement to develop titles based on a new animated series…


Konami Digital Entertainment today announced that it has signed a worldwide agreement with Alliance Atlantis Communication to develop games based on their new animated series, Dragon Booster.

Dragon Booster is described as a mythic good versus evil struggle in a classic, yet timeless world where humans and dragons co-exist. The hero is Artha Penn, an ordinary teenager who is plunged into an incredible adventure when he is chosen to ride Beaucephalis, the dragon of legend. When teamed with Beau, Artha is transformed into a mythical hero known as the Dragon Booster -- a hero charged with the task of saving the world from an impending war and uniting humans and dragons for once and for all. Dragon Booster is high-octane adventure set against the backdrop of dragon racing where 12-ton reptiles chew up the asphalt at over 200 miles per hour!

Channel 5 will be featuring the animated series in early 2005 for those that wish to check it out, whilst the game is expected to follow shortly after.

âWe are very proud to be expanding our licensed game catalogue and anime content with the addition of Dragon Booster,â said Mr. Kazumi Kitaue, Chief Executive Officer at Konami Digital Entertainment, Inc. âOur mission is to listen to our consumers and deliver entertainment that fits with the target market. At KDE, we plan to continue to acquire licensed properties that resonate with our consumers, such as we have done with Dragon Booster.â

âDragon Booster was thoughtfully crafted from its inception not only to provide our video game partner with compelling, rich content, but to deliver key elements specific to the gaming community, in turn providing our partner with a tremendous pool of resources, characters and freedom from which to build an exciting video game franchise with global appeal,â said Jennifer Bennett, Vice President, Merchandising and Licensing at ALLIANCE ATLANTIS. âKonami was a perfect fit for us and for Dragon Booster and it is with great pleasure I announce their appointment as our worldwide video game partner.â
